4245 文字
11 分

AI時代の高速化を牽引するLightpanda: 次世代ヘッドレスブラウザの全貌

AI時代の幕開けとヘッドレスブラウザの進化

近年、AI技術の目覚ましい発展は、私たちのデジタルライフに革命をもたらしています。特に、AIエージェントがウェブサイトとインタラクションする機会が増加するにつれて、従来のウェブブラウザのあり方にも変化が求められています。Webブラウザは元来、人間が視覚的に情報を理解し、操作することを主眼に設計されてきました。しかし、AIエージェントのような機械が主たるユーザーとなる未来においては、その設計思想は根本から見直されるべきです。こうした背景から、AIと自動化に特化した、より高速で効率的なヘッドレスブラウザの需要が高まっています。

<!-- IMAGE_PLACEHOLDER:headless-browser-evolution -->

Lightpanda: AIと自動化のためにゼロから設計されたヘッドレスブラウザ

この新たな潮流を牽引する存在として、オープンソースのヘッドレスブラウザ「Lightpanda」が登場しました。lightpanda-ioによって開発されたこのプロジェクトは、AIおよび自動化ワークロードの特定の要件を満たすために、ゼロから綿密に設計されています。その革新性は、既存のデスクトップブラウザをAI用途に「後付け」するのではなく、AIワークロードに最適化された設計を最初から目指した点にあります。これは、2027年頃にはAIエージェントが主要なブラウザユーザーとなる可能性さえ示唆されており、設計の優先順位が「人間中心」から「機械中心」へと反転するという未来を見据えたアプローチです。

Lightpandaは、そのパフォーマンスにおいて目覚ましい進化を遂げています。公開されているベンチマークによれば、従来のヘッドレスブラウザと比較して最大で9倍(または11倍とも言われる)高速化を実現しており、リソース消費も大幅に削減されています。この圧倒的な速度向上は、大量のデータスクレイピング、複雑な自動化タスク、そしてAIモデルのトレーニングや評価といった、計算リソースを大量に消費するワークロードにおいて、計り知れないメリットをもたらします。

卓越したパフォーマンスの秘密:Zig言語の採用と非Chromiumアーキテクチャ

Lightpandaの驚異的なパフォーマンスの背後には、その開発言語とアーキテクチャの選択が大きく貢献しています。開発チームは、C++やRustといった成熟した言語ではなく、Zig言語を採用するという大胆な決断を下しました。Zig言語は、低レベルのメモリ管理を可能にしつつ、C言語との互換性、そして簡潔で表現力豊かな構文を持つことで知られています。開発者の一人は、「C++やRustで大規模プロジェクトを構築するには、自分の知能では足りないと感じた。Zigを選んだのは、より効率的に、より少ないコードで、より高いパフォーマンスを実現できると考えたからだ」と述べています。この選択は、Lightpandaがリソース効率と実行速度を極限まで追求する上で、決定的な役割を果たしています。

さらに、LightpandaはChromiumベースではありません。多くのヘッドレスブラウザがPuppeteerやPlaywrightといったツールを通じてChromiumエンジンに依存しているのに対し、Lightpandaは独自のブラウザエンジンを構築しています。これにより、Chromiumの持つオーバーヘッドや、AIワークロードには不要な機能を取り除くことが可能となり、純粋にブラウジングのコア機能とパフォーマンスに焦点を当てた設計が実現されています。この非Chromiumアーキテクチャは、軽量化と高速化に大きく寄与しており、AIエージェントがウェブ全体を効率的にクロールし、データを処理する能力を飛躍的に向上させます。

既存ツールとの互換性と移行の容易さ

Lightpandaのもう一つの重要な特徴は、既存の開発ワークフローへの統合の容易さです。CDP (Chrome DevTools Protocol) を介して、PuppeteerやPlaywrightといった一般的なヘッドレスブラウザ自動化ツールとの互換性を確保しています。これは、既にChromiumベースのヘッドレスブラウザを使用してスクレイピングや自動化を行っている開発者にとって、大きなメリットとなります。既存のコードベースに大きな変更を加えることなく、Lightpandaを導入することで、パフォーマンスを劇的に向上させることが可能です。GitHubリポジトリのREADMEには、「数行のコード変更で、既存のヘッドレスChrome環境からLightpandaに切り替えることができます」と記されており、その導入の容易さが強調されています。

この互換性は、開発者が新しい技術スタックを学習・導入する際の障壁を低減し、迅速なイテレーションとデプロイメントを可能にします。AIエージェントの開発や、大規模なウェブスクレイピングプロジェクトにおいて、パフォーマンスのボトルネックとなっていたブラウザ処理を解消することは、プロジェクト全体の成功に不可欠です。

Lightpandaの現状と今後の展望:ベータ版における挑戦とコミュニティの力

Lightpandaは、その革新的なアプローチと目覚ましいパフォーマンスにもかかわらず、現時点ではベータ版という位置づけです。開発チームは、GitHubのIssueセクションやDiscordコミュニティを通じて、ユーザーからのフィードバックを積極的に収集し、開発に活かしています。READMEには正直に、「Web APIは数百種類存在します。Lightpandaはまだそのすべてを網羅しているわけではありません」と明記されており、一部のウェブサイトでは表示の問題やクラッシュが発生する可能性があることが示唆されています。ブラウザエンジンの構築は非常に複雑なタスクであり、すべてを完璧に網羅するには時間と労力が必要です。

しかし、この正直さと透明性は、オープンソースプロジェクトとしての信頼性を高めています。Lightpandaは、LinuxおよびmacOS向けのナイトリービルドを提供しており、Dockerイメージも利用可能です。これにより、コンテナ化された環境での利用も容易になっています。また、セルフホスティングを望まないユーザーのために、マネージドクラウドバージョンも提供されています。

GitHubでは、プロジェクトは急速に注目を集めており、短期間で10,000スターを超える勢いを見せています(※検索結果の時点での情報、将来的なスター数は変動する可能性があります)。これは、AIおよび自動化分野におけるLightpandaへの期待の大きさを物語っています。開発チームは、オープンソース、AI、開発ツールに情熱を持つ人材を積極的に募集しており、プロジェクトのさらなる発展に意欲的です。

最近のリリースでは、マルチスレッドサポートの導入も進められており、#1353 のプルリクエストにより、単一のLightpandaプロセスに対して複数のCDP接続が可能になりました。これにより、各CDP接続は独立したブラウザインスタンスとして機能しつつ、プロセス全体でのリソース共有や連携が期待されます。これは、並列処理能力をさらに向上させ、より複雑な自動化シナリオへの対応を可能にする重要な一歩です。

AIエージェントと自動化の未来におけるLightpandaの役割

AIエージェントがウェブの世界でより能動的な役割を担うようになるにつれて、高性能なブラウザエンジンは不可欠なインフラストラクチャとなります。Lightpandaは、まさにこの未来を見据えて設計されており、AIがウェブとシームレスに連携するための強力な基盤を提供します。ウェブスクレイピングの効率化、AIによるコンテンツ生成の高速化、そしてより複雑な自動化ワークフローの実現など、Lightpandaがもたらす影響は多岐にわたります。

例えば、ウェブサイトの分析や市場調査において、膨大な量のデータを迅速かつ効率的に収集できることは、迅速な意思決定と競争優位性の確立に繋がります。また、AIモデルの学習データセットの構築においても、Lightpandaの高速なクロール能力は、データ収集プロセスを大幅に加速させることができます。

Lightpandaの存在は、開発者がより高度なAIアプリケーションや自動化ツールに集中できる環境を提供します。ブラウザのパフォーマンスに関する懸念を払拭し、開発者はより創造的で価値の高いタスクにリソースを割くことが可能になります。これは、AI分野全体のイノベーションを加速させる触媒となり得るでしょう。

まとめ:Lightpandaが切り拓く、AI時代のウェブ自動化の新境地

Lightpandaは、AIと自動化の時代に求められるパフォーマンスと効率性を実現するために、ゼロから設計された革新的なヘッドレスブラウザです。その非Chromiumアーキテクチャ、Zig言語の採用、そして既存ツールとの互換性により、開発者は以前にも増して高速かつ効率的なウェブ自動化を実現できます。ベータ版でありながらも、そのポテンシャルは計り知れず、開発コミュニティの活発な貢献とともに、日々進化を続けています。

AIエージェントがウェブの主要なユーザーとなる未来において、Lightpandaのような、機械のために最適化されたブラウザは、不可欠な存在となるでしょう。このプロジェクトは、単なる開発ツールに留まらず、AIとウェブの融合を加速させ、新たなデジタル体験を創造するための重要な一翼を担うことが期待されます。Lightpandaの今後の展開から目が離せません。

以下の動画で、Lightpandaのコンセプトとデモンストレーションについて詳しく解説しています。

" title="YouTube video player" frameborder="0" allow="accelerometer; autoplay; clipboard-write; encrypted-media; gyroscope; picture-in-picture; web-share" allowfullscreen>

SNS投稿文
261文字
AI時代の高速化を牽引するLightpanda: 次世代ヘッドレスブラウザの全貌 既存ブラウザを圧倒する性能でAIワークロードを革新するLightpandaが登場。次世代ヘッドレスブラウザは、開発者コミュニティに新たな可能性をもたらし、自動化とAI処理の高速化を実現。その革新的な設計思想と技術的特徴は、AI時代における必須ツールとして注目を集めています。 Lightpandaの革新性と技術的特徴を深掘り。AIワークロードに特化した設計思想が、開発効率と処理速度を飛躍的に向上させます。詳細はこちらからご覧ください。
URL: https://retrocraft.jp/posts/20260316184125/ 合計: 305文字
AI時代の高速化を牽引するLightpanda: 次世代ヘッドレスブラウザの全貌
https://retrocraft-web.pages.dev/posts/20260316184125/
作者
RetroCraft
公開日
2026-03-16
ライセンス
CC BY-NC-SA 4.0